Canada was regarded as a safe haven after slavery was abolished throughout the British Empire on August 1, 1834 (August 1 is Emancipation Day in Canada), and it was the terminus for at least 30,000 enslaved people, believed to be as many as 100,000, who travelled the Underground Railroad.\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"MsoNormal\" align=\"center\" style=\"margin-bottom: .0001pt; text-align: center; line-height: normal;\"\u003e\u003cb\u003e\u003cspan style=\"mso-fareast-font-family: 'Times New Roman'; mso-bidi-font-family: Calibri; mso-bidi-theme-font: minor-latin;\"\u003eIncludes serialized certificate.\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/b\u003e\u003cspan style=\"mso-fareast-font-family: 'Times New Roman'; mso-bidi-font-family: Calibri; mso-bidi-theme-font: minor-latin;\"\u003e The Royal Canadian Mint certifies all of its collector coins, including this one, which has a limited mintage of just 5,500 coins worldwide.\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"MsoNormal\" align=\"center\" style=\"margin-bottom: .0001pt; text-align: center; line-height: 16.5pt;\"\u003e\u003cb\u003e\u003cspan style=\"mso-fareast-font-family: 'Times New Roman'; mso-bidi-font-family: Calibri; mso-bidi-theme-font: minor-latin; color: black;\"\u003ePackaging\u003cbr\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/b\u003e\u003cspan style=\"mso-fareast-font-family: 'Times New Roman'; mso-bidi-font-family: Calibri; mso-bidi-theme-font: minor-latin; color: black;\"\u003eYour coin is encapsulated and presented in a black Royal Canadian Mint-branded clamshell with a black beauty box.\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"MsoNormal\" align=\"center\" style=\"margin-bottom: .0001pt; text-align: center; line-height: 16.5pt;\"\u003e\u003cb\u003e\u003cspan style=\"mso-fareast-font-family: 'Times New Roman'; mso-bidi-font-family: Calibri; mso-bidi-theme-font: minor-latin; color: black;\"\u003eAugust 1 is Emancipation Day in Canada\u003cbr\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/b\u003e\u003cspan style=\"mso-fareast-font-family: 'Times New Roman'; mso-bidi-font-family: Calibri; mso-bidi-theme-font: minor-latin; color: black;\"\u003eThe Underground Railroad helped many people of African descent escape enslavement in the American South, but until the 19th century, slavery existed in British North America (Canada) too. While anti-slavery measures had already been enacted in some Canadian jurisdictions, the \u003ci\u003eSlavery Abolition Act, \u003c\/i\u003e1833, that came into effect on August 1, 1834 abolished slavery across most of the British Empire, including present-day Canada. In reality, freedom came more gradually to some and equality was far from assured. But the imperial statute represents a monumental milestone in Black Canadian history, and it shaped the view of Canada as a safe haven and a popular terminus for those who travelled the \"Freedom Train.\"\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"MsoNormal\" align=\"center\" style=\"margin-bottom: .0001pt; text-align: center;\"\u003e\u003cspan style=\"mso-bidi-font-family: Calibri; mso-bidi-theme-font: minor-latin;\"\u003e \u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e","brand":"Monnaie JD Coins","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":45757697949887,"sku":null,"price":149.95,"currency_code":"CAD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0521\/0957\/4335\/files\/2022_20CommemoratingBlackHistoryTheUndergroundRailroad-PureSilverCoin1ozPureSilverCoin_1.jpg?v=1781990645","url":"https:\/\/monnaiesjdcoin.ca\/products\/2024-canada-20-commemorating-black-history-amber-valley-pure-silver-copy","provider":"Monnaie JD Coins","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
